CSPC: Michael Jackson Popularity Analysis
Physical Singles Sales – Part 1
As a reminder, the weighting is done with a 10 to 3 ratio between one album and one physical single.
Got to be There (1972) – 1,488,000 equivalent albums
Got to be There – 2,130,000
Rockin’ Robin – 1,970,000
I Wanna Be Where You Are – 680,000
Ain’t No Sunshine – 180,000
Ben (1972) – 747,000 equivalent albums
Ben – 2,490,000
Music & Me (1973) – 69,000 equivalent albums
With A Child’s Heart – 160,000
Morning Glow – 25,000
Music & Me – 25,000
Happy – 20,000
Forever, Michael (1975) – 204,000 equivalent albums
We’re Almost There – 230,000
Just A Little Bit Of You – 450,000
Got to be There, Rockin’ Robin and Ben were all massive US hits. In terms of schedule, they perfectly followed the smashes of the Jackson 5. In fact, combined the brothers sold 25 million singles from 1970 to 1972, an incredible total. The years from 1973-1975 were nowhere near as big with less than 1 million sales in total.
